 The Economics of Property-Casualty Insurance by David F. Bradford, "The Economics of Property-Casualty Insurance presents new research and findings on key aspects of the economics of the property-casualty insurance industry. The volume explores the industrial organization, regulation, financing, and taxation of this business. The first paper, on external financing and insurance cycles, contains a wealth of information on trends and patterns in the industry's financial structure. The last essay, which compares performance of stock and mutual insurance companies, takes a fresh look at the way a company's organizational structure affects its responses to different economic situations. Two papers focus on rate regulation in the auto insurance industry, and provide broad overviews of the structure and economics of the insurance industry as a whole. Also addressed are the system of regulating insurance companies in the United States, who insures the insurers, and the effects of tax law changes in the 1980s on the prices of insurance policies.
Chartered Property Casualty Underwriter - A Chartered Property Casualty Underwriter (CPCU) is an insurance professional designation. The curriculum includes 10 courses covering insurance contracts, business, and ethics. Casualty Actuarial Society - The Casualty Actuarial Society (CAS) is a professional society of actuaries. Its members are mainly involved in the property and casualty areas of the actuarial profession. Casualty insurance - Casualty insurance is a broad category of insurance that includes almost any coverage that is not related to life, health, or property.
